Output b66a14e64da588b3b2cca547dfe9d4603b40c0f0e79654e7a2b94c0c4fdc893d:1

value
2499557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 686f10fa8580e676ecee60bf2b1d254d064dad98 OP_EQUAL
address
3BDDFWy8u8DpNkvveQJwLZ3C16mxtmpdKM
transaction
b66a14e64da588b3b2cca547dfe9d4603b40c0f0e79654e7a2b94c0c4fdc893d